front brake poporting valve brake bleeding problem
i run a porshing valve teed off my rear brakes that runs to one off the front brake calipars. when it hit the rear brake pedal it works both front brake and rear.
i have and double banjo bolt in the rear brake with 2 lines one goes to the rear. the other goes through the adjustable valve then to the front brake calipar.
i have run this set up for years . the trouble is i cant get it to bleed. have push fluid through both calipars , and tried suction as well. the rear is fine its the front calipar.
I know on a car you have to get a special tool that holds open the proportioning valve, I made one for a jeep I had to bleed the brakes on. Basically it was just a piece of thin steel with a u shaped slot in it. Post a pic of the valve.
